@charset "UTF-8";
/* CSS Document */

.aboutBox {
	padding-top: 10px;
	margin-bottom: 80px;
}
.aboutBox .inner {
	width: 1000px;
}
.aboutBox .inner dl {
	margin-bottom: 5px;
    padding: 10px 0;
}
.aboutBox .inner dl:nth-child(2n+1) {
	background-color: #F9F9F9;
}
.aboutBox .inner dl:after {
	content: '';
	clear: both;
	display: block;
}
.aboutBox .inner dl dt {
	float: left;
	width: 185px;
	text-align: right;
	font-weight: bold;
	padding: 15px 20px;
}
.aboutBox .inner dl dd {
	float: left;
	width: 800px;
	border-left: 1px dotted #CCC;	text-align: left;
	padding: 15px 20px;
	letter-spacing: -0.05em;
}


@media screen and (max-width: 736px) {

.aboutBox .inner {
	padding: 20px;
}
.aboutBox .inner {
	width: 100%;
	padding: 0 2vw;
}
.aboutBox .inner dl {
	padding: 0 2vw;
}
.aboutBox .inner dl dt {
	float: none;
	width: 100%;
	text-align: left;
	padding: 5px 10px;
	border-bottom: 1px dotted #CCC;
}
.aboutBox .inner dl dd {
	float: none;
	width: 100%;
	text-align: left;
	border-left: none;
	padding: 5px 10px;
}
}

	
